Addressing Critical Challenges in Steelmaking Charging Areas: The Technical Advantages of Mullite-SiC Refractory Bricks

In the harsh environment of steelmaking charging areas and coke quenching chutes, refractory materials face relentless thermal shocks, severe abrasion, and chemical corrosion. Traditional refractories often fail prematurely, leading to unplanned shutdowns, increased maintenance costs, and production inefficiencies. Recent industry reports indicate that refractory-related issues account for approximately 18% of unplanned downtime in steelmaking operations, resulting in average losses of $220,000 per hour for major steel producers.

The Technical Breakthrough: Sunrise Mullite-SiC Refractory Brick Architecture

Sunrise has engineered a proprietary Mullite-SiC refractory solution that addresses these challenges through three key technical innovations. The material achieves a remarkable porosity level below 10% (typically 8-9% in commercial production) and a high bulk density of 2.8-3.0 g/cm³, significantly exceeding industry standards for conventional alumina-silica refractories.

Performance Advantages: Beyond Traditional Refractories

Performance Parameter Sunrise Mullite-SiC Brick Conventional High-Alumina Brick Improvement
Cold Crushing Strength (MPa) ≥200 120-150 33-67%
Thermal Shock Resistance (cycles, 1100°C-water quench) ≥50 15-25 100-233%
Apparent Porosity (%) 8-9 18-22 50-60%
Load Softening Temperature (°C, 0.2MPa) ≥1650 1450-1550 7-14%

The multiphase modified microstructure of Sunrise Mullite-SiC bricks creates a material with exceptional thermal shock resistance. By integrating silicon carbide whiskers throughout the matrix, the material effectively dissipates thermal stress, preventing the propagation of cracks that typically lead to premature failure in traditional refractories.

Field-Proven Performance in Global Steel Mills

In a six-month case study at a major Indian steel producer, Sunrise Mullite-SiC bricks demonstrated a service life extension of 220% in the charging zone compared to the previous refractory solution. The installation reduced maintenance cycles from 2 months to over 7 months, resulting in an estimated annual savings of $420,000 in downtime and material replacement costs.

Third-Party Certification:

Complies with ASTM C279, ISO 8890, and DIN 51060 standards for refractory materials. Independent testing by TÜV SÜD confirms thermal shock resistance exceeding 50 cycles at 1100°C water quench.

Another installation at a European steel mill's coke quenching chute showed similar impressive results, with wear rates reduced by 65% compared to the previous alumina-chrome bricks. This not only extended service life but also improved workplace safety by minimizing dust generation and material spalling.
